- The distance between Uzgorod, Ukraine and Huntington/ Tri-State, Wv, Usa is approximately 7,843 km or 4,873 mi.
- To reach Uzgorod in this distance one would set out from Huntington/ Tri-State, Wv bearing 42.7°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Uzgorod bearing 126.5° or SE .
- Uzgorod has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Huntington/ Tri-State, Wv has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Uzgorod is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Huntington/ Tri-State, Wv is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 3.1 °C (5.6°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1 °C (1.8°F) less in Uzgorod.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 313.9 mm (12.4 in) less which is equivalent to 313.9 l/m² (7.7 US gal/ft²) or 3,139,000 l/ha (335,580 US gal/ac) less. About 5/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10.2° lower in Uzgorod than in Huntington/ Tri-State, Wv.
